Decide which kind of swap is right for you. The most common option is the swapping of primary residences, in which case both parties are vacationing at precisely the same time in each others' homes. If you own greater than one home, you can participate in nonsimultaneous swaps so you could travel at a different time than the person with whom you're swapping. With this kind of swap, you may be able to exchange timeshares and vacation rentals. Another sort of nonsimultaneous exchange could involve inviting a person to stay in your house while you are there, and vice versa.

If you own a vacation rental house, you should have a lawyer look over your rental agreement to be sure it is in conformity with all relevant laws. Additionally, make sure your agreement complies with all rules and covenants that could be distinctive to the location of your home's, such as a homeowner's or condominium association. Both the property owner and the renter should sign and date the arrangement, and a copy should be kept by both parties.
Determine if you desire to record it yourself or whether you want to list your vacation property through a property management company. A third party is a superb choice for those who don't need to handle paperwork, the tenant screenings, and trade. Keep in mind that a management company also can be hired to take care of maintenance and problems that may appear with renters. This is particularly useful if you do not have the time to rectify a renter's trouble on short notice or should you not live close enough to the property to handle problems promptly.

The contract should also contain a cancellation policy that will deter a renter from backing out of the transaction. If the property is in an area prone to natural disasters including hurricanes, floods or earthquakes the contract should include a good faith clause that will release the renter from the contract if a calamity occurs before the lease and renders the property uninhabitable.
Have all conditions in writing for the vacation home rental,. The contract must state the location of the property, dates of leasing, total rental cost and rent payment program. Any individual policies such as policies relating to occupancy limitations, pets, and smoking also must be in the contract. Contain a damages clause, which defines deposit rules and financial repercussions affecting any damages done to the property.
